
Svetitskhoveli Cathedral, Tbilisi (Georgia)
The Svetitskhoveli Cathedral is an Orthodox Christian cathedral located in the historic town of Mtskheta Georgia to the northwest of the Georgian capital Tbilisi. A masterpiece of the Early and High Middle Ages Svetitskhoveli is recognized by UNESCO as a World Heritage Site. It is currently the second largest church building in Georgia after the Holy Trinity Cathedral.
